New for FC in Fall, 2006

Freshman Connections featured two major changes in its Fall, 2006 program.

  • Freshman Connections integrated two new residential "special interest" groups into its team structure: a residential unit in LaFollette complex for Pre-Business majors and a residential unit in Woodworth Hall for Nursing majors.  These joined the already existing team for TCOM majors.
  • A new team was organized to meet the needs of commuting students.  To prepare for this team, a focus group of new commuter students met during the summer to identify critical topics and plan programs for the fall semester.

The Princeton Review featured Ball State as "one of the best college values in the nation," in the 2007 edition of America's Best Value Colleges.  The guidebook highlighted "Ball State's success in building a sense of community, particularly through the Freshman Connections program, which places first-year students from the same residence hall in several of the same required courses."
